Structural fo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ation to identify signs of damage or deterioration, such as cracks, uneven settling, or bowing walls. Repair methods may include installing underpinning systems, pushing or lifting settled sections back into place, or reinforcing weak areas to restore the foundation’s strength. The goal is to stabilize the structure, prevent further damage, and ensure the safety and longevity of the property.

These repair services are essential for resolving common foundation problems caused by soil movement, moisture imbalance, or aging materials. Over time, shifts in soil conditions can lead to uneven settling, resulting in cracks in the walls or floors, sticking doors and windows, and other structural concerns. Addressing these issues promptly through professional foundation repair can help prevent more extensive and costly damage, such as compromised load-bearing elements or structural failure.

Properties that typically require foundation repair include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older properties are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to the natural aging of materials and changes in soil conditions over time. Additionally, properties located in areas prone to heavy rainfall or expansive clay soils may experience more frequent foundation movement, increasing the need for professional repair services.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from approximately $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For example, minor crack repairs may cost closer to $2,000, while extensive underpinning could exceed $7,000.

Labor and Material Expenses - The cost for labor and materials generally accounts for a significant portion of the total, with prices varying based on the project's complexity. Expect to pay around $50 to $150 per hour for skilled labor, plus materials that can add several thousand dollars to the overall cost.

Type of Repair and Materials - Costs differ depending on whether the repair involves mudjacking, piering, or underpinning, with each method having different material costs. For instance, mudjacking might range from $500 to $1,300 per slab, while underpinning can be substantially more expensive.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or exterior doors.

How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repair methods vary but often invol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ore stability and prevent further damage.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, large or growing cracks, or those accompanied by other issues, should be evaluated by a specialist to determine if repair is needed.

How long does a typical foundation repair take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the repair method but generally ranges from a few days to a week.
